The Electoral Commission (IEC) of South Africa has urged South Africans who want to vote in the 2024 elections, to continue to register at the Commission's offices or on its online platform. Over half a million South Africans registered or updated their details at voting stations across the country on the second day of the voter registration drive. In a statement, the IEC says yesterday's voter registration got off to a smooth start with 34 293 online registrations recorded. This past weekend, the IEC held its second 2024 elections voter registration weekend. This follows the first one, held in November last year, where over 2.9-million South Africans registered or updated their details on the voters' roll. Currently, there are more than 27 million registered South Africans eligible to make their mark. Chief Electoral Officer of the Electoral Commission of South Africa Sy Mamabolo.
